Why Cross-Chain Technology Is a Game-Changer for Cryptocurrency Trading
In the ever-evolving landscape of cryptocurrency, cross-chain technology is emerging as a revolutionary force, transforming how trading occurs across various blockchain networks. This innovative technology enables different blockchains to communicate and interact with each other, creating a more fluid trading environment.
One of the primary benefits of cross-chain technology is enhanced interoperability. Historically, most cryptocurrencies operated within their own ecosystems, limiting trading options and liquidity. With cross-chain capabilities, traders can access a wider array of digital assets, leading to more robust trading strategies and opportunities. For example, users can now seamlessly swap Bitcoin for Ethereum or trade altcoins without being confined to a single blockchain.
This increased flexibility not only improves the user experience but also boosts overall market liquidity. When assets can move freely between platforms, trading volumes rise, attracting more participants to the market. Higher liquidity often results in tighter spreads and better prices, ultimately benefiting traders.
Moreover, cross-chain technology plays a critical role in enhancing security. By allowing transactions to occur across multiple chains, it reduces reliance on any single platform, thus mitigating the risks of hacks and fraud. Smart contracts can be employed to facilitate secure asset transfers between chains, ensuring that transactions are executed as intended without intermediaries.
Another significant advantage of cross-chain technology is the potential for innovation in decentralized finance (DeFi). As DeFi platforms become more interconnected, users can access a plethora of financial services, such as lending, borrowing, and yield farming, without the limitations of a single blockchain. This openness fosters a more competitive environment, driving improvements in interest rates and service quality.
Cross-chain technology also empowers projects to utilize the strengths of various blockchains. For instance, a project could leverage Ethereum’s smart contract capabilities while tapping into the speed of Binance Smart Chain for transactions. This ability to utilize the best features of different blockchains can lead to more efficient applications and services within the crypto ecosystem.
Furthermore, the rise of cross-chain decentralized exchanges (DEXs) illustrates a significant shift in the trading paradigm. DEXs utilizing cross-chain technology allow users to trade assets without ever relinquishing control of their private keys, enhancing user sovereignty and reducing the risks associated with centralized exchanges.
